    The H&R Model 1880 is a classic revolver manufactured by Harrington & Richardson, a company established in 1871 in Worcester, Massachusetts. This model, chambered in .32 S&W, exemplifies H&R’s commitment to producing reliable and affordable firearms during the late 19th and early 20th centuries.
